Как устроены серверные операционные системы
Серверные операционные системы представляют собой специализированное программное обеспечение для управления аппаратурными ресурсами компьютера. Организация таких систем основывается на принципе многозадачности и многопользовательского доступа. Ядро координирует работу процессора, операционной памяти, дисковых носителей и сетевых интерфейсов.
Основу образует модульная архитектура, где каждый компонент исполняет установленные функции. Драйверы гарантируют взаимодействие с реальным оборудованием. Планировщик задач делит вычислительные ресурсы между процессами. Файловая система упорядочивает размещение сведений на дисках.
Серверная вавада объединяет сервисы для обработки сетевых запросов и старта приложений. Системные библиотеки обеспечивают процессам встроенные процедуры для операций с возможностями. Средства изоляции процессов блокируют конфликты между программами.
Интерфейс командной строки дозволяет управляющим регулировать опции и проверять статус системы. Записи событий сохраняют сведения о работе модулей вавада онлайн казино. Такая структура обеспечивает стабильную деятельность аппаратуры под интенсивной нагрузкой.
Чем серверная ОС разнится от обычной
Основное расхождение заключается в назначении и способе применения. Десктопные системы заточены на функционирование одного оператора с оконными приложениями. Серверные решения обрабатывают множество параллельных соединений и исполняют скрытые задачи без участия человека.
Графический интерфейс в серверных вариантах нередко отсутствует или минимизирован. Контроль реализуется через командную строку и настроечные файлы. Такой подход сокращает расход возможностей и увеличивает быстродействие. Пользовательские версии предоставляют графические средства для ежедневных операций.
Серверные решения обеспечивают улучшенные возможности увеличения. Платформы vavada работают с огромными размерами памяти и множеством процессорных cores. Устойчивость и непрерывность деятельности жизненно существенны для серверного программного обеспечения. Системы проектируются для беспрерывного работы без перезагрузок. Системы резервации предохраняют от отказов. Настольные варианты допускают периодические перезапуски и менее притязательны к надежности.
Ключевые задания серверных систем
Серверные решения выполняют совокупность функций по обеспечению работы сетевых услуг и приложений:
- Осуществление входящих сетевых подключений и направление трафика.
- Активация и надзор функционирования клиентских утилит и веб-сервисов.
- Разделение процессорной ресурсов между активными процессами.
- Отслеживание состояния технических элементов и софтверных компонентов.
- Создание логов событий для анализа скорости.
Программное обеспечение синхронизирует связь между клиентскими аппаратами и расчетными средствами. Организация обеспечивает параллельно обрабатывать тысячи запросов от различных операторов.
Сохранение и контроль информацией представляет центральную роль серверных платформ. Файловые хранилища обеспечивают доступ к документам, медиафайлам и бэкапам. Системы управления базами данных выполняют систематизированную информацию. Системы резервного копирования предохраняют важные сведения от пропажи.
Система обеспечивает разделение клиентских сред и программ. Виртуализация позволяет запускать ряд автономных казино вавада на одном аппаратном компьютере. Распределение загрузки выделяет задачи между доступными возможностями для эффективной эффективности.
Как выполняются запросы клиентов
Ход осуществления стартует с приема обращения через сетевой интерфейс. Входящее соединение поступает в буфер, где ждет своей очереди. Сетевой слой изучает порции данных и выявляет целевой службу. Маршрутизатор отправляет запрос релевантному программному элементу.
Модуль извлекает сведения и осуществляет заданные операции. Утилита может подключиться к файловой системе для извлечения или сохранения сведений. База данных отдает искомые строки. Вычислительные операции реализуются процессором соответственно важности процесса.
Параллельная организация позволяет обрабатывать совокупность запросов параллельно. Каждое коннект получает выделенный поток выполнения. Планировщик делит вычислительное время между запущенными операциями. Серверная вавада отслеживает потребление памяти и пресекает исчерпание возможностей.
Сформированный ответ высылается обратно заказчику через сетевое соединение. Протоколы транспортного уровня обеспечивают доставку сведений. Журнал регистрирует сведения о произведенной операции и статусе окончания. Освобожденные возможности делаются доступными для очередных обращений.
Администрирование ресурсами и нагруженностью
Оптимальное разделение ресурсов предоставляет стабильную деятельность всех сервисов. Диспетчер процессов устанавливает первоочередности потоков и назначает CPU время. Механизмы распределения блокируют перегрузку индивидуальных элементов. Мониторинг отслеживает текущее положение устройств в реальном времени.
Оперативная память распределяется между запущенными процессами гибко. Средство свопинга применяет файловое объем при нехватке физической памяти. Кэширование повышает доступ к регулярно запрашиваемым данным. Автоматическая сборка высвобождает пустующие участки памяти.
Дисковые операции ускоряются через очереди обращений и упреждающее загрузку. Файловая система группирует ассоциированные информацию для минимизации времени подключения. Серверные vavada поддерживают горячую смену хранилищ без остановки деятельности.
Сетевая модуль управляет транспортную производительность магистралей передачи. Регулирование пропускной способности блокирует захват bandwidth отдельными подключениями. Ранжирование трафика предоставляет уровень работы значимых модулей. Метрики нагрузки содействует организовывать расширение системы.
Охрана и управление входа
Охрана информации и ресурсов базируется на многоуровневой модели разграничения привилегий. Каждый клиент приобретает уникальный код и набор привилегий. Аутентификация проверяет легитимность пользовательских аккаунтов при авторизации. Пароли содержатся в зашифрованном виде для исключения незаконного подключения.
Права обращения к документам и каталогам настраиваются персонально для каждого элемента. Владелец ресурса устанавливает допустимые процедуры для остальных операторов. Объединения собирают регистрационные записи с одинаковыми привилегиями. Серверная казино вавада отклоняет действия исполнения запретных действий.
Межсетевой экран проверяет приходящий и отправляемый данные по установленным критериям. Списки управления сужают подключения с указанных IP-адресов. Системы детектирования атак проверяют аномальную активность. Шифрование предохраняет пересылаемую данные от перехвата.
Протоколы безопасности регистрируют все старания подключения к ограниченным ресурсам. Проверка событий способствует обнаружить отступления стандартов. Автоматические сообщения информируют управляющих о опасных событиях. Постоянное обновление настроек приспосабливает платформу к современным рискам.
Функционирование с сетью и соединениями
Сетевая компонент предоставляет коммуникацию сервера с сторонними устройствами и иными серверами. Сетевые карты принимают и отправляют данные по разнообразным форматам. Драйверы контроллеров управляют реальными портами. Конфигурация IP-адресов регулирует опознание машины в сети.
Набор протоколов TCP/IP обрабатывает пересылку данных на различных уровнях. Роутинг направляет пакеты к назначенным узлам через эффективные маршруты. DNS-резолвер конвертирует доменные названия в цифровые координаты. DHCP самостоятельно распределяет сетевые настройки присоединенным устройствам.
Контроль коннектами включает надзор действующих сессий и таймаутов. Резервы соединений повторно эксплуатируют открытые пути для оптимизации ресурсов. Серверные вавада обслуживают тысячи одновременных TCP-соединений за счет результативным схемам. Балансеры распределяют входящий данные между несколькими узлами.
Мониторинг сетевой поведения контролирует пропускную способность и латентность. Тестовые средства контролируют достижимость удаленных узлов. Статистика портов демонстрирует величины отправленных данных и количество неполадок. Настройка очередей улучшает эффективность при разнообразных видах нагрузки.
Обновления и поддержание системы
Периодическое апдейт программного обеспечения предоставляет охрану и стабильность деятельности. Производители распространяют фиксы для устранения брешей и дефектов. Менеджеры пакетов механизируют получение и инсталляцию обновлений. Управляющие проектируют внедрение правок в интервалы слабой загрузки.
Тестирование апдейтов на изолированных окружениях исключает непредвиденные отказы. Резервное дублирование конфигурации позволяет оперативно откатить корректировки при неполадках. Серверная vavada предоставляет функции возврата к старым релизам блоков.
Контроль состояния контролирует наличие свежих редакций приложений и модулей. Сообщения оповещают о срочных патчах безопасности. Автоматизированные тесты обнаруживают неактуальные блоки. Регламенты актуализации назначают приоритеты и периоды развертывания модификаций.
Техническая поддержка разработчиков предоставляет советы по настройке и решению проблем. Группа клиентов делится опытом выполнения задач. Хранилища информации хранят мануалы по настройке. Платные соглашения обеспечивают предоставление обновлений в течение конкретного периода.
Где используются серверные операционные системы
Веб-хостинг является одну из главных областей использования серверных решений. Фирмы размещают порталы и веб-приложения на физических или виртуальных узлах. Системы выполняют HTTP-запросы от множества пользователей регулярно.
Организационные сети опираются на серверную архитектуру для размещения данных и запуска бизнес-приложений. Файловые серверы обеспечивают консолидированный доступ к материалам. Почтовые решения обрабатывают коммуникацию организации. Базы данных включают данные о покупателях и денежных операциях.
Облачные операторы формируют расширяемые решения на базе серверных платформ. Виртуализация позволяет генерировать изолированные среды для различных клиентов. Серверные казино вавада обеспечивают масштабируемость и результативность облачных услуг.
Научные операции нуждаются высокопроизводительных серверных кластеров для осуществления больших количеств данных. Аналитические организации воспроизводят комплексные процессы. Медицинские заведения размещают электронные записи клиентов на безопасных серверах. Академические платформы обеспечивают доступ к образовательным данным.
